Believe it or not, Ghost Rider's head is actually a digital representation of Nicholas Cage's real skull. They made moldings of his teeth and x-ray scans of his skull and used them to render a fairly true to life version of Nicholas Cage's skull as Ghost Rider's head. So, if you think that Ghostie's head is misshaped, then it's only because of Nic's own misshapen skull. :lol:

Well, I saw the movie on Friday evening, and I enjoyed it very much.
I will say that this is a movie that was kinda made for fans of the comic book. The origin of the character was somewhat rushed in order to get into the action as soon as possible. As a fan of the character, I had no problem with that, but someone who doesn't know this character might feel a bit confused.
The special effects were amazing. Ghost Rider looks and sounds exactly like I would have imagined him to. The transformation sequence was incredibly realistic and very well executed. There really wasn't a point in the movie that I was like "Ah, that's so fake."
On the negative side, there were four villains for Ghost Rider to have to deal with. With only 2 hours to do so, battles that could have been quite dramatic and epic simply feel effortless and anti-climactic. It would have been much better if they had limited it to one or two baddies.
Overall, it is definitely worth watching at least once. Fans of the comic will definitely get more out of the story, but everyone else will at least get a thrill from the effects and get a taste of a character that usually doesn't get the same kind of appreciation and recognition as characters like Spider-Man and the X-Men.
I give it 3.5 out of 5 stars. A pretty good score as far as comic book movies go. :mrgreen:
